Tyn-Y-Gongl's LL74 postcode sits in Isle Of Anglesey. The board behind it is assembled from 1,912 sales over 32 years of actual sales in 3 areas.
Across the recorded period the typical LL74 sale went from £52,000 in 1995 to £285,000 in 2026 — 5.5× growth. If you could time-travel once, aim for just before 2003 — prices moved +43.0% that year. The one to avoid was 2023: the median moved -10.1%, the roughest year in the local record.
Median sold price in LL74
| Year | Median sold price | Sales |
|---|---|---|
| 1995 | £52,000 | 57 |
| 2000 | £70,000 | 71 |
| 2005 | £180,000 | 59 |
| 2010 | £170,000 | 41 |
| 2015 | £177,000 | 65 |
| 2020 | £248,000 | 59 |
| 2025 | £279,950 | 33 |
| 2026 | £285,000 | 9 |
